CSHP Selects Jay Rho As 2008 Pharmacist Of The Year And Mirta Millares For Distinguished Service, California

Drs. Veronica Bandy, Daniel Dong and Maria Serpa Designated as 2008 Society Fellows and Darren Besoyan to Receive Technician Achievement Award.

At a time when an increasing number of Californians are managing their health with daily medications and pharmacists are playing a growing leadership role in patient care, the California Society of Health-System Pharmacists (CSHP) has recognized several of its members for their outstanding professional dedication with its highest honors.

Jay Rho, PharmD, FASHP, FCSHP, has been selected as CSHP's 2008 Pharmacist of the Year. Rho serves as Area Pharmacy Director at the Kaiser Permanente Los Angeles Medical Center.

"Jay has distinguished himself in every role he has filled and has mentored many students and pharmacists who have become leaders in our profession," said John Carbone, PharmD.

Mirta Millares, PharmD, FASHP, FCSHP, has been selected as the recipient of CSHP's Distinguished Service Award. Millares is Manager of Kaiser Permanente's Drug Information Services and Pharmacy Outcomes Research for California.

"Mirta is an exceptionally gifted and talented pharmacist, and her dedicated contributions have influenced us in so many positive ways," said CSHP past president Brian Hodgkins.

The 2008 Fellows --Veronica Bandy, PharmD, FCSHP, with Walgreens Pharmacy in Stockton; Daniel Dong, PharmD, FCSHP with Northern California Kaiser Permanente; and Maria Serpa, PharmD, FCSHP, with Sutter Medical Center, Sacramento - are formally recognized as pharmacists who have demonstrated a consistent commitment to educating students, practitioners, and the public about the practice of pharmacy.

Darren Besoyan, with UC Davis Medical Center in Sacramento, will receive the Technician Achievement Award for his active promotion of the advancement of the technician's role in pharmacy. All recipients will be recognized at Seminar 2008, CSHP's annual meeting on October 9-10 at the Disneyland Hotel in Anaheim.

Founded in 1962, the California Society of Health-System Pharmacists represents over 3,800 pharmacists and associates who serve patients and the public by promoting wellness and the best use of medications. CSHP members practice in a variety of organized healthcare settings -- hospitals, health maintenance organizations, clinics, home healthcare, and ambulatory care settings.
